### Step 2: Update Your Plugin for the New Reset Flow

Heads up, plugin authors: Fernhollow's revamped password reset no longer fires the old `reset.requested` hook. You'll want to subscribe to the new `identity.reset.initiated` event instead, which carries a signed payload rather than a raw token. Dual-firing ends with the next minor release, so migrate soon. To test locally, run the sandbox identity service with the configuration below.

deployment values, yahag-tawef:
ZORWYN_HOST=zorwyn.tolvaqlabs.internal
ZORWYN_PORT=9300

## Changelog — Fareline Pricing Service

We changed the default allocation for the dynamic ticket-pricing experiment from 5% to 20% of sessions. New joiners: this affects checkout totals in the Brightvale staging region, so expect variance in regression snapshots. Rollback requires a config push, not a redeploy. The experiment now launches with the following defaults.

settings of fafog-yajof:
ulaael:
  log_level: warn
  metrics_host: metrics.ulaael.zemvarlabs.internal
  pin: 7979
  pool_size: 32

Internal Memo — Sales Leads

Churn in the Bramfield pilot hit 14% last month, double forecast. Exit interviews point to onboarding friction and a pricing mismatch for smaller accounts. Actions: Tolan's team ships the simplified setup flow next sprint; a revised tier for sub-50-seat customers goes live in two weeks. Hold all renewal outreach until the new tier is confirmed. Implications for the programme's future are set out in the note below.

management briefing: Jorixax Holdings is in early talks to buy Casixax Holdings for about $420.3 million. The Fenmir launch date is October 27, and nothing goes to the press before then. Legal wants the Keloxek Foods term sheet redrafted before April 16.

Runbook — Lumafn account recovery during cold starts. Lumafn serverless handlers can take up to twelve seconds on a cold start; the recovery endpoint is no exception. If your first recovery request times out, wait for the warm instance rather than retrying rapidly, as repeated attempts trip the lockout counter. Once the prompt loads, complete recovery with the passphrase that follows.

vault phrase of tajef-tafog = istox-sorax-zorox-casok-holox-kelix-weneth-drueth-casion